What is the slope of the line that passes through the points left bracket, minus, 9, comma, 0, right bracket(−9,0) and left bracket, minus, 17, comma, 4, right bracket(−17,4)? Write your answer in simplest form.

The slope of a line passing through two points (x_1, y_1) and (x_2, y_2) can be calculated using the formula (y_2 - y_1)/(x_2 - x_1).

In this case, the points are (-9, 0) and (-17, 4).

So, the slope is (4 - 0)/(-17 - (-9)) = 4/(-17 + 9) = 4/(-8) = -1/2.

Therefore, the slope of the line passing through the points (-9, 0) and (-17, 4) is -1/2.
